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C).
In a mixing bowl, combine the brown sugar, Dijon mustard, olive oil, minced garlic, salt, black pepper, thyme, and apple cider vinegar (if using). Whisk the ingredients until well mixed.
Place the chicken thighs in a baking dish or oven-safe skillet. Pour the marinade mixture over the chicken, making sure to coat each piece evenly. You can also let the chicken marinate in the refrigerator for up to 2 hours for enhanced flavor.
Once the chicken is coated, place the baking dish in the preheated oven.
Bake for 25-30 minutes, or until the chicken reaches an internal temperature of 165°F (75°C) and the skin is golden brown.
Remove the chicken from the oven and let it rest for 5 minutes before serving.
For a crispy skin, broil the chicken for an additional 2-3 minutes at the end of the baking time.
